With our cell phones and pda’s, we are now able to be in touch with anyone and everyone at any time. In the process, we run the risk of never being in touch with ourselves. … What about not connecting with anyone in our “in-between” moments? What about realizing that there are actually no in-between moments at all? What about being in touch with who is on this end of the line, not the other end? What about calling ourselves up for a change, and checking in, seeing what we are up to? What about just being in touch with how we are feeling, even in those moments when we may be feeling numb, or overwhelmed, or bored or disjointed, or anxious or depressed, or needing to get one more thing done?

Arriving at Your Own Door - 108 Lessons in Mindfulness by Jon Kabat-Zinn
